Two Much

Two Much

Year: 1995

Runtime: 118 mins

Language: English

Director: Fernando Trueba

ComedyRomance

A chaotic comedy follows Art Dodge, an indebted painter‑turned‑gallerist whose scheme to marry a wealthy divorcee spirals out of control. He falls for the divorcee’s sister, invents a fictitious twin to court her, and must contend with the former husband’s vengeful plans, all while two sisters discover unexpected ties.

Time period

Mid-1990s

The story unfolds in a contemporary mid-1990s era, with stylish outfits, modern cars, and a media-driven vibe. This period’s social dynamics and tabloid culture drive the urgency and humor of the plot. The backdrop reflects a city obsessed with appearance, money, and glamorous excess.

Location

Miami Beach, Florida

Set against the sun-drenched glamour of Miami Beach, the film uses beaches, luxury cars, and chic galleries to frame its high-society comedy. The Lincoln Road area functions as a social hub where art, wealth, and romance collide. The setting emphasizes wealth, fashion, and the art world as both playground and battleground.

Main Characters – Two Much (1995)

Meet the key characters of Two Much (1995), with detailed profiles, motivations, and roles in the plot. Understand their emotional journeys and what they reveal about the film’s deeper themes.

Art Dodge – Antonio Banderas

An improvised con artist and struggling artist who racks up debt trying to keep his gallery afloat. He engineers fake identities to romantically court two sisters simultaneously. His charm masks a willingness to gamble safety for affection and success.

Gloria – Joan Cusack

Art's practical assistant who keeps the gallery running and helps manage the chaotic plan. She acts as the domestic stabilizer, coordinating schemes while keeping a wary eye on the consequences. Her loyalty and quick thinking keep the farce from collapsing.

Manny – Gabino Diego

A fellow artist whose studio becomes a strategic resource in Art's ruse. He supports and participates in the artistic backdrop of the con, providing a cover for the deception and adding texture to the creative world at play.

Gene – Danny Aiello

A mob-connected businessman and Betty's husband/partner who still loves her and exerts control. He uses threats to test Art's commitment and pushes the plot toward a dramatic wedding-day confrontation. His protective, intense nature anchors the mounting tension.

Betty – Melanie Griffith

A wealthy heiress who impulsively falls for Art and pushes for a quick marriage. Her flirtation with risk and glamour fuels the story's romance and comic energy. Ultimately, her loyalty shifts toward true love and away from a rushed arrangement.

Liz – Daryl Hannah

Betty's sister and an art professor who is cool and distant at first, then drawn to Bart and to Art. Her initial skepticism gives way to genuine attraction, creating tension as she discovers the truth behind the masquerade. She embodies the intelligent, wary romantic interests at the heart of the film.

Bart (Art's Imaginary Twin)

Art's invented, glasses-wearing twin who provides a lie-in-motion for the double-dating plot. Bart is used to explain away Art's simultaneous appearances and keeps the deception alive, though he ultimately exposes the truth when confronted.

Major Themes – Two Much (1995)

Explore the central themes of Two Much (1995), from psychological, social, and emotional dimensions to philosophical messages. Understand what the film is really saying beneath the surface.

🎭 Identity

Art crafts a web of fake identities to pursue love and money, driving most of the plot’s misunderstandings. The duplicity creates tension and comic situations as characters react to uncertain loyalties. The film uses disguise to probe what people will do to keep up appearances and secure affection.

💘 Romance

Romance propels a love-triangle between Art, Betty, and Liz, forcing him to juggle two sisters at once. The pursuit blends humor with genuine emotion, testing whether true feelings can survive deception. The climax hinges on choosing between fantasy and real connection.

💰 Wealth / Status

Money and social standing motivate many actions, from Betty’s heiress status to Gene’s mob connections. The art world becomes a stage where wealth buys access and heightens risk. The comedy also critiques how luxury can blur moral lines and catalyze schemes.

🎨 Art World

Art and painting frame the plot as both currency and passion. Manny's studio and the gallery scenes anchor Art's deception while revealing his genuine talent. The narrative treats art as a social game and a source of personal meaning.
